Sound familiar?

Other delivery apps are taking too much from your business.

"They take ₱37,500 from my ₱150,000 monthly sales"

On 300 orders a month at ₱500 average, other apps deduct ₱37,500–₱42,000 in commission. That's money that should be going to your ingredients, your staff, and your growth.

"There are hidden fees on top"

Marketing fees, penalty charges, auto-deductions — the real cost with other platforms is always higher than what they advertise. And leaving feels impossible.

"I had to raise my prices"

To cover those commissions, restaurants mark up online prices 20–30%. Your customers notice — and some stop ordering altogether.

Got questions? We've got answers.

How much does Qenina charge per order?
A flat ₱50 booking fee per order. With split booking, this is shared 50/50 — ₱25 for the restaurant, ₱25 for the customer. No percentage-based commission, ever.
Do I need a PayMongo account?
Yes. PayMongo handles payment processing so money goes directly to your bank account — not ours. Setting up is free and takes about 5 minutes.
What happens when my credits run out?
Just top up with more credits anytime. No subscription, no auto-renewal. You buy credits when you need them.
Is there a contract or lock-in?
No contracts, no lock-in, no monthly fees. You prepay for credits and use them at your own pace. Stop anytime.
Can I use my own delivery riders?
Yes! You can use your own riders with custom delivery fees and radius settings, or use Lalamove's automated dispatch. Switch between them per order.
How fast can I go live?
Under 15 minutes. Register, connect PayMongo, upload your menu, and share your link. That's it.
